WordPress Plugins That Save Bloggers Time

WordPress Plugins That Save Bloggers Time

Personally, I feel it is essential for bloggers to track the activity on
their blogs. You can make use of a web analytics tool, but it takes sometime
to navigate through all the reports. That is where a plugin will be handy.
The WordPress.com Stats plugin is a big help in this regard. Instead of
using another application, you can keep track of your blog's stats directly
from your WordPress dashboard.

2. WP-Polls

It is a well-known fact that people like to participate in polls. There are
options available to you on the internet, but the WP-Polls plugin will allow
you to create custom polls on your WordPress dashboard. You do not have to
leave your account to log into another site to manage it. This is only if
you want to make use of polls.

3. Sociable

This plugin automatically add links to your favorite social bookmarking
sites on your posts, pages and in your RSS feed. You can choose from 99
different social bookmarking sites.

4. Akismet

It is very important to activate your Akismet plugin on your blog. It is a
fact that blogs unfortunately get comments that are spam. This plugin checks
your comments against the Akismet web service to see if they look like spam
or not and lets you review the spam it catches under your blog's "comments"
admin screen. Your readers do not like to see spam comments. This can easily
result in a decrease of your traffic. I cannot stress this enough, please
make sure you are using a plugin like Akismet. This WordPress plugin will
save you time.

5. Math Comment Spam

In the fast growing era of technology, it is unfortunately a fact that
comment spam blocking plugins like Akismet will not always be enough to
eliminate all spam comments. By using the Math Comment Spam plugin in
conjunction with the Akismet plugin, you will be able to decrease spam
comments. The Math Comment Spam plugin will ask readers a simple math
problem such as 2 x 3 before they can comment. This is to make sure that it
is a human comment.

6. Theme Tester

Editor's Note: The Theme Tester plugin may not work with newer versions of
WordPress. A good alternate plugin is Theme Test Drive which can be found
at: http://wordpress.org/extend/plugins/theme-test-drive/

It sometimes happens that bloggers want to change the WordPress theme. You
do not want your audience to see the changes until all is finished and
ready. This is where the Theme Tester plugin is of great help. Your readers
will see your existing design until all is set up and ready for publishing.

7. WP-Database Backup

I want you to read the following with attention! If your blog is important
to you, do yourself a big favor and install the WP-Database Backup plugin.
It is most crucial to have this plugin installed and set to back up your
WordPress database. This plugin will save the data on your hard drive or it
will be sent to you via email. The next important point I want to stress is
the following: Please keep in mind that this plugin makes a backup of your
database files only. Make sure to make a manual backup of your WordPress
content folder from your hosting account.

8. Easytube

This plugin will help you to get a YouTube or Google video published on your
blog. It easily makes embedding YouTube and Google videos into your post a
snap. Easytube also includes a preview image of your YouTube videos in the
RSS feed with a link to the video. If you want to make use of visual media,
it is essential to install this plugin.

9. Auto Close Comments, Pingbacks and Trackbacks

To reduce spam on older posts, you can make use of this plugin. Older posts
are targets for automated comment spam bots. After installing the plugin,
set the timeframe to a date when you want to close comments on your posts.

10. Google Maps Plugin

Editor's Note: The Google Maps plugin may not work with newer versions of
WordPress. A good alternate plugin is the Comprehensive Google Map plugin
which can be found at:
http://wordpress.org/extend/plugins/comprehensive-google-map-plugin/

This plugin speaks for itself. If you want to make use of maps from Google
to be part of your blog post, this plugin will assist you in the process of
creating, inserting and customizing it. This WordPress plugin will
definitely save you time.

I really hope these 10 WordPress plugins will save you time and make
blogging a treat. Make use of them and enjoy your blogging!
